ASP中实现数据库分页查询的技术方法探讨

AI绘图结果,仅供参考

在ASP(Active Server Pages)中实现数据库分页查询,是处理大量数据时常用的技术手段。通过分页可以有效减少页面加载时间,提升用户体验。

实现分页的核心在于控制每次从数据库中获取的数据量。通常使用SQL语句中的LIMIT子句或者ROWNUM等数据库特定的语法来限制返回记录数。例如,在MySQL中可以使用LIMIT 0,10来获取前10条记录。

在ASP中,可以通过动态生成SQL语句的方式实现分页逻辑。根据当前页码和每页显示数量,计算出起始记录的位置,并将该值作为参数传递给数据库查询。

同时,还需要考虑如何显示分页导航。通常会在页面底部添加“上一页”、“下一页”或具体的页码链接,用户点击后能跳转到相应页面。这需要在ASP中处理请求参数,并根据参数值调整查询条件。

为了提高性能,应尽量避免在分页时进行全表扫描。可以结合索引优化查询效率,确保分页操作不会对数据库造成过大负担。

•还需注意防止SQL注入攻击,对用户输入的页码参数进行验证和过滤,确保其为合法数值。

总体来说,ASP中的分页查询实现并不复杂,但需要合理设计数据库结构、优化SQL语句,并做好前端交互与安全性处理。

dawei

【声明】:宁波站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。